Bethany's Quilt

Following a Chinese tradition, I am making a "100 Good Wishes" Quilt for my daughter Bethany who is somewhere in China. To celebrate a new life, a quilt is made from 100 squares of fabric donated by family and friends. Contributers also put their "good wish" on paper with a small sample of their fabric. These "wishes" will be compiled in a scrapbook so I can tell Bethany about all the people who sent their good wishes before they ever met her.
